Home
last modified time | relevance | path

Searched refs:tracks (Results 1 – 12 of 12) sorted by relevance

/hardware/interfaces/bluetooth/audio/2.0/default/session/
DBluetoothAudioSession.cpp345 struct playback_track_metadata* track = source_metadata->tracks; in UpdateTracksMetadata()
349 sourceMetadata.tracks.resize(track_count); in UpdateTracksMetadata()
350 halMetadata = sourceMetadata.tracks.data(); in UpdateTracksMetadata()
/hardware/libhardware/include/hardware/
Daudio.h219 struct playback_track_metadata* tracks; member
225 struct record_track_metadata* tracks; member
/hardware/interfaces/audio/core/all-versions/default/
DStreamOut.cpp565 halTracks.reserve(sourceMetadata.tracks.size()); in updateSourceMetadata()
566 for (auto& metadata : sourceMetadata.tracks) { in updateSourceMetadata()
575 .tracks = halTracks.data(), in updateSourceMetadata()
DStreamIn.cpp460 halTracks.reserve(sinkMetadata.tracks.size()); in updateSinkMetadata()
461 for (auto& metadata : sinkMetadata.tracks) { in updateSinkMetadata()
478 .tracks = halTracks.data(), in updateSinkMetadata()
DDevice.cpp245 if (sinkMetadata.tracks.size() == 0) { in openInputStream()
253 AudioSource source = sinkMetadata.tracks[0].source; in openInputStream()
/hardware/interfaces/audio/4.0/
Dtypes.hal139 vec<PlaybackTrackMetadata> tracks;
155 vec<RecordTrackMetadata> tracks;
/hardware/interfaces/audio/common/6.0/
Dtypes.hal184 * It is also used with output tracks and patch tracks, which never have a
704 FAST = 0x4, // output supports "fast tracks", defined elsewhere
734 FAST = 0x1, // prefer an input that supports "fast tracks"
817 vec<PlaybackTrackMetadata> tracks;
841 vec<RecordTrackMetadata> tracks;
/hardware/interfaces/audio/common/5.0/
Dtypes.hal178 * It is also used with output tracks and patch tracks, which never have a
698 FAST = 0x4, // output supports "fast tracks", defined elsewhere
728 FAST = 0x1, // prefer an input that supports "fast tracks"
811 vec<PlaybackTrackMetadata> tracks;
835 vec<RecordTrackMetadata> tracks;
/hardware/interfaces/audio/common/2.0/
Dtypes.hal108 PATCH = 12, // For internal audio flinger tracks. Fixed volume
178 * It is also used with output tracks and patch tracks, which never have a
658 FAST = 0x4, // output supports "fast tracks", defined elsewhere
686 FAST = 0x1, // prefer an input that supports "fast tracks"
/hardware/interfaces/audio/common/4.0/
Dtypes.hal164 * It is also used with output tracks and patch tracks, which never have a
610 FAST = 0x4, // output supports "fast tracks", defined elsewhere
640 FAST = 0x1, // prefer an input that supports "fast tracks"
/hardware/qcom/audio/hal/
Daudio_hw.c4879 || sink_metadata->tracks == NULL) { in in_update_sink_metadata()
4889 device = sink_metadata->tracks->dest_device; in in_update_sink_metadata()
/hardware/interfaces/keymaster/4.0/
DIKeymasterDevice.hal923 * o Tag::MAX_USES_PER_BOOT must be compared against a secure counter that tracks the uses of